Job Description

Job Overview
We are seeking a skilled and dedicated Service Desk Engineer to join our dynamic IT support team. The ideal candidate will possess a strong technical background and excellent customer service skills, ensuring that all users receive timely and effective support. This role involves troubleshooting a variety of hardware and software issues, providing desktop support, and maintaining effective communication with users to resolve their IT-related problems.

Responsibilities

Provide first-line technical support for hardware and software issues across various operating systems, including Microsoft Windows and macOS.
Troubleshoot and resolve issues related to computer networking, VPNs, firewalls, and TCP/IP configurations.
Assist users with Active Directory management, including user account creation and permissions.
Conduct software troubleshooting for applications within the Microsoft Office suite and other business-critical software.
Maintain documentation of support requests using tools such as BMC Remedy, ServiceNow, or Jira.
Perform desktop support tasks, including installation, configuration, and maintenance of computer hardware.
Monitor system performance and conduct regular analysis to identify potential issues before they escalate.
Collaborate with other IT teams to ensure seamless service delivery and resolution of complex technical problems.
Provide training and guidance to end-users on best practices for IT usage.
Experience

Proven experience in a technical support or help desk role is essential.
Strong understanding of computer networking principles and protocols (TCP, DNS).
Familiarity with Microsoft Windows Server environments and Active Directory management is required.
Experience with SCCM for software deployment is advantageous.
Knowledge of Linux operating systems is a plus.
Excellent communication skills with the ability to convey technical information clearly to non-technical users.
Strong customer service orientation with a commitment to resolving user issues efficiently.
